Converter, Catalytic: Installation: 3.2L: Notes
FRONT CATALYTIC CONVERTER
- If new gaskets need replacing, position new gasket onto the manifold flange. Loosely install the lower bolt.
- Position the catalytic converter (3) against the manifold.
- Install the upper flange bolts. Tighten all the bolts (1) to 23 N.m (17 ft. lbs.).
- Position the cross-under pipe (1) to the catalytic converter. Tighten the nuts (1) to 26 N.m (19 ft. lbs.).
- Install the support bolt (5). Tighten to 23 N.m (17 ft. lbs.).NOTE:
Using care, do not to twist or kink the oxygen sensor wires.
- Reconnect the electrical connectors (1, 2).
- If removed, install the oxygen sensors (3, 5). Tighten the sensors to 50 N.m (37 ft. lbs.).
- Install the belly pans (1).
- Lower the vehicle.
- Connect the negative battery cable. If equipped with an Intelligent Battery Sensor (IBS), connect the IBS connector.
- Start the engine and inspect for exhaust leaks. Repair exhaust leaks as necessary.
- Check the exhaust system for contact with the body panels. Make the necessary adjustments, if needed.
